Why the World Is Moving Toward Biodegradable Products

Plastic has been used for decades due to its low cost, light weight and durability. But with increased use of plastic comes immense environmental issues all over the world.

World environmental reports show that millions of tonnes of plastic waste are added to oceans, rivers and landfills annually. Packaging, food packaging, shopping bags, straws and disposable containers are all examples of single-use plastics that are some of the biggest sources of pollution.

Microplastics are present in:

  • Oceans and marine life
  • Drinking water
  • Agricultural soil
  • Human blood and food chains

Governments are setting strict regulations on the use of plastic as environmental awareness has grown. Several single use plastic products have already been banned/restricted in many countries including India.

Sustainable packaging is also on consumers’ mind. Companies that utilize green products are building up more trust and loyalty for their brand.

This worldwide change is driving a huge demand for biodegradable and compostable alternatives.

What Are Biodegradable Products?

Biodegradable products are products that are known to be decomposed by biological agents like bacteria, fungi and other microorganisms without causing any long term environmental effects.

Biodegradable materials are substances that can be decomposed into natural products such as water, carbon dioxide and biomass when conditions are met, unlike conventional plastic.

Typical biodegradable products are:

  • Compostable carry bags
  • PLA drinking straws
  • Paper water bottles
  • Bagasse food containers
  • Bio-based disposable cutlery
  • Packaging films for corn starch
  • Cassava starch bags

Eco-friendly cups and trays – both single-use and reusable options are welcome.

The market for these products is growing and becoming a substitute for conventional plastic packaging in retail, food service, healthcare, logistics and e-commerce.

India’s Growing Role in Biodegradable Manufacturing

With its robust agriculture prowess and industrial framework, India is emerging as one of the most promising biodegradable manufacturing markets.

The country has several benefits as a sustainable product manufacturing country:

1. Abundant Raw Materials

The following are manufactured in India in bulk:

  • Sugarcane
  • Corn
  • Rice
  • Wheat
  • Cassava

The sources of agricultural material from which biopolymers and starch materials for biodegradable products are manufactured.

2. Government Support

Increasing demand for eco-friendly alternatives has emerged because of the ban imposed on single-use plastics by the Indian Government. Certain state governments also support the green manufacturing industry by providing industry support schemes.

3. Growing Domestic Demand

There is an increasing tendency to use eco-friendly packaging by various sectors of the food industry such as restaurants, supermarkets, e-commerce delivery providers and brand companies.

4. Export Opportunities

Indian manufacturers of biodegradable products are exporting the following:

  • Europe
  • Middle East
  • Southeast Asia
  • North America

India is a good sourcing country due to competitive production costs and availability of raw material.

Paper Water Bottles: A Revolutionary Packaging Innovation

Paper water bottles are one of the most promising advancements in the world of sustainable packaging.

The global beverage companies are pouring large amounts of capital into paper-based bottle applications to cut down on plastic waste and make their brands more sustainable.

The bottled water industry is a multi-hundred-billion-dollar business worldwide! This would generate a huge new manufacturing industry even if it’s just a small switchover from plastic bottles to paper alternatives.

Advantages of Paper Water Bottles

  • Reduced plastic consumption
  • Better environmental image
  • Strong consumer acceptance
  • Export potential
  • Compliance with future sustainability regulations

Environmental regulations around the globe are getting tougher and tougher and consequently, the demand for paper bottle packaging will also rise quite a bit.

For Indian entrepreneurs, this is a low-competition sector and is an attractive option to enter into the early stages.

Rapid Growth of Biodegradable Food Packaging

The growth of food delivery apps, cloud kitchens and quick-service restaurants has driven the need for huge amount of compostable food packaging products.

Currently, food and beverage establishments are working to switch from plastic containers to containers which can be biodegraded using bagasse from sugarcane, corn starch and PLA products.

Some popular biodegradable food packaging products are:

  • Plates
  • Bowls
  • Cups
  • Food trays
  • Takeaway containers
  • Compostable spoons and forks

The bagasse tableware is particularly becoming popular due to its:

  • Biodegradable
  • Heat resistant
  • Food-safe
  • Commercially scalable

Starch-based carry bags and compostable packaging films also are quickly replacing traditional plastic grocery bags in many countries.

Most Profitable Biodegradable Manufacturing Businesses

There are a number of growth areas in the packaging manufacturing business where entrepreneurs can turn their attention to the sustainable packaging industry.

  1. Biodegradable Carry Bag Manufacturing

The number of compostable shopping bags are on the rise because of plastic bans in various countries.

  1. Paper Water Bottle Production

A newly emerging industry that holds good export potential and long-term potential for growth.

  1. Bagasse Tableware Manufacturing

Disposable eco-friendly plates and containers are widely used by most restaurants and catering companies.

  1. PLA Product Manufacturing

PLA (Polylactic Acid) is a bio-based bio-degradable polymer that can be used to make cups, straws, food films, and food containers.

  1. Corn Starch Packaging Film Manufacturing

Used in the retail and logistics industries for eco-friendly packaging.

  1. Cassava Starch Bag Manufacturing

Cassava derived biodegradable bags have witnessed increasing popularity in the European and Asian markets.
